0c6856cf03 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: implement driver camera preview in settings ( #35480 )  
							
							... 
							
							
 
							
							* implement driver camera preview in settings
rebase master
* rename to dialog 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								f0f249ecf8 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: implement change language in settings ( #35481 )  
							
							... 
							
							
 
							
							implement change language in settings 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								a3daca8fd5 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: implement PrimeAdWidget ( #35496 )  
							
							... 
							
							
 
							
							implement PrimeAdWidget 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								8220599dd8 
								
									
								
							
								 
							
						 
						
							
							
								
								raylib: onroad callback setter ( #35493 )  
							
							... 
							
							
 
							
							* onroad callback setter
* fix name 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								7c5155590f 
								
									
								
							
								 
							
						 
						
							
							
								
								raylib: simpler callbacks ( #35488 )  
							
							... 
							
							
 
							
							* simpler no current callback
* clean up
* back
* fixx
* clean up 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								2c59b5f8c6 
								
									
								
							
								 
							
						 
						
							
							
								
								raylib: common mouse press hook ( #35489 )  
							
							... 
							
							
 
							
							* something like this
* need these
* rest
* another pr
* what is this merge conflict
f
* fix mouse down
* rm that!
* fix that
* rearrange
* fix bug where mouse held down on widget, dragged off, then let go
* temp
* fix that
* missing init 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								2031a33188 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: add experimental mode toggle button with visual indicator ( #35446 )  
							
							... 
							
							
 
							
							* add experimental mode toggle button with visual indicator
* merge master
* implement a temporary state hold after mouse click"
* move to seperate class
---------
Co-authored-by: Shane Smiskol <shane@smiskol.com> 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								c145de96f9 
								
									
								
							
								 
							
						 
						
							
							
								
								raylib: match QT UI panel order ( #35487 )  
							
							... 
							
							
 
							
							match QT UI panel order 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								3ce87d0ac9 
								
									
								
							
								 
							
						 
						
							
							
								
								raylib: base widget class ( #35484 )  
							
							... 
							
							
 
							
							* use some widgets
* consistent name draw -> render
* more
* rest 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								29830440b4 
								
									
								
							
								 
							
						 
						
							
							
								
								format raylib ( #35483 )  
							
							... 
							
							
 
							
							* format raylib
* not really sure what this is 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								6767bfce44 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: add ModalOverlay system for unified modal dialog management ( #35478 )  
							
							... 
							
							
 
							
							add ModalOverlay 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								2000f9aff3 
								
									
								
							
								 
							
						 
						
							
							
								
								raylib: ban non-cached measure_text_ex ( #35462 )  
							
							... 
							
							
 
							
							* add
* use it
* Update pyproject.toml
* many more
* comment 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								3a622cbe25 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: add WiFi manager to settings ( #35454 )  
							
							... 
							
							
 
							
							add WiFi manager to settings 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								6b59f67ab5 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: implement home layout with fully functional offroad alerts ( #35468 )  
							
							... 
							
							
 
							
							implement home layout with offroad alerts 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								459179ff6c 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: fix settings close button shape and press state ( #35469 )  
							
							... 
							
							
 
							
							fix button rounding and pressed state display in settings 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								8b516abb31 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: replace rl.measure_text with measure_text_cached in sidebar ( #35450 )  
							
							... 
							
							
 
							
							Replace rl.measure_text with measure_text_cached 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								96cfd5aaf7 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: add ListView component and settings layouts with declarative UI ( #35453 )  
							
							... 
							
							
 
							
							* add flexible ListView component
* fix crash
---------
Co-authored-by: Shane Smiskol <shane@smiskol.com> 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								88466fb62f 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: improve onroad layout transitions ( #35458 )  
							
							... 
							
							
 
							
							improve onroad layout transitions 
							
						 
						
							5 months ago  
				
					
						
							
							
								 
						
							
							
								2e41d959ac 
								
									
								
							
								 
							
						 
						
							
							
								
								ui: add main UI entry point ( #35422 )  
							
							... 
							
							
 
							
							* add new main UI entry point
* cleanup
* mv to selfdrive/ui
* fix imports
* handle_mouse_click
* use ui_state
* remove ui_state from gui_app
* setup callbacks
* handle clicks
* put layouts in a dict
* update state in render
* rebase master
* implement settings sidebar
* rename files 
							
						 
						
							5 months ago